[PATCH 1/4] Input - synaptics: fix middle button on Lenovo 2015 products

From: Benjamin Tissoires
Date: Wed Jan 28 2015 - 15:53:52 EST


On the X1 Carbon 3rd gen (with a 2015 broadwell cpu), the physical middle
button of the trackstick (attached to the touchpad serio device, of course)
seems to get lost.

Actually, the touchpads reports 3 extra buttons, which falls in the switch
below to the '2' case. Let's handle the case of odd numbers also, so that
the middle button finds its way back.

drivers/input/mouse/synaptics.c | 6 +++++-
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/input/mouse/synaptics.c b/drivers/input/mouse/synaptics.c
index f89de89..0d12664 100644
--- a/drivers/input/mouse/synaptics.c
+++ b/drivers/input/mouse/synaptics.c
@@ -689,7 +689,7 @@ static int synaptics_parse_hw_state(const unsigned char buf[],

if (SYN_CAP_MULTI_BUTTON_NO(priv->ext_cap) &&
((buf[0] ^ buf[3]) & 0x02)) {
- switch (SYN_CAP_MULTI_BUTTON_NO(priv->ext_cap) & ~0x01) {
+ switch (SYN_CAP_MULTI_BUTTON_NO(priv->ext_cap)) {
default:
/*
* if nExtBtn is greater than 8 it should be
@@ -698,15 +698,19 @@ static int synaptics_parse_hw_state(const unsigned char buf[],
break;
case 8: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[5] & 0x08)) ? 0x80 : 0;
+ case 7: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[4] & 0x08)) ? 0x40 : 0;
case 6: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[5] & 0x04)) ? 0x20 : 0;
+ case 5: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[4] & 0x04)) ? 0x10 : 0;
case 4: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[5] & 0x02)) ? 0x08 : 0;
+ case 3: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[4] & 0x02)) ? 0x04 : 0;
case 2: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[5] & 0x01)) ? 0x02 : 0;
+ case 1:
hw->ext_buttons |= ((buf[4] & 0x01)) ? 0x01 : 0;
}
}
